Zynga, the social gaming outfit behind Farmville and Mafia wars, has inked a distribution pact with  Yahoo. Yahoo will put Zynga games on the home page, Yahoo Games, Yahoo Mail and Yahoo Messenger.
For Zynga, the Yahoo deal is a bit of a diversification play since the company is dependent on Facebook for a lot of its usage. In any case, it’s a win-win for Yahoo and Zynga.
Zynga games are expected to roll out on the Yahoo! network in the coming months and will include:
- Ability for people to play Zynga games and access their personal Zynga game updates across Yahoo!’s properties including the Homepage, Yahoo! Games, Yahoo! Mail, Yahoo! Messenger and others.
- Sharing of updates across multiple social experiences simultaneously while playing their favorite Zynga games on Yahoo!
- Product integration of Zynga games with the Yahoo! Application Platform (YAP), Yahoo!’s OpenSocial container through which third-party developers can develop applications on Yahoo!
Mark Pincus, founder and CEO of Zynga:
“With over 35 million unique users playing our games every single day, social games are fast becoming a leading source of entertainment worldwide surpassing most television shows. Our partnership with Yahoo! gives millions of new users the ability to connect with friends and families through games.”
